What you should know:
1. The clinic will provide primary, mental and specialty care services to the more than 10,500 veterans in Youngstown.
2. The clinic will notably have a food pantry attached to provide food to those in need.
3. The new clinic will be 10,000 square feet larger than the current Youngstown clinic Veterans Affairs operates.
4. VA Northeast Ohio Healthcare operates 13 outpatient clinics.
